One person is dead after a vehicle collided with a train in Zorra Township this morning at the crossing on the 31st line just north of Dundas Street.
ZORRA TOWNSHIP - Oxford OPP are investigating a fatal collision on 31st Line in Zorra Township.
Police say a vehicle collided with a train at the crossing just north of Dundas Street. The driver of the vehicle was pronounced deceased at the scene.
Roads 68-74 will be closed to traffic for an extended period of time to facilitate the investigation.
